I have been quoted £400 for a full respray, because of my new kit want to get the whole thing done at once.

Thats in a standard manufacturer colour, split colour I asked about for top and bottom different was £500.

Seen this guys work done and seen the quality, so I would say £400-£600 is about right.

Depends though, if you go to certain bodyshops they will be talking more around £1000-£1500.

Aye am in the trade.

It all depends on the size of the paintshop to be honest.

A small business, one man, one booth, ur probably lookin at around 400 - 600 depending on chips dents etc.
A larger business which is using its reputation (All these modded car overpriced places) may charge 1000 + for a job of the same standard.

Its not gonna cost much more than 300 in materails then + labour for a couple of days.

Am not sure wot that colour is like but unless it contains a flip/flake etc i doubt it will cost much more.

yeah, but i bet thats not the car completely stripped with the windows out. The doors taken off, the tailgate off, the bonnet off, The bumpers off. With the shuts getting just as good of a finish as the major panels. We priode our selves on producing the best. This takes time, and time means paying people.

When we paint a car, we paint it properly, we dont just mask up what doesnt need to be painted.
We also give the car a twin coat of lacquer, so when the car gets lacquered it gets baked, flattened down, remasked and recoated in lacquer for a deaper/ glossier finish.

The car then gets flattened and polished to a finish which is probably better than most factory finishies.

The paint we use gives the customer a 5 year warrenty scheme, more than any other scheme/company.

Our paint facilites arte among the best in the country. Thats why our price is £1500.

Its not just a case of do a few repairs, key the paint and stick a new coat on it, with a crappy old booth that probably gives a nice dusty/dirty basecoat. Or painting with a pish compressor thans probably blowing more oil and water onto the car than paint.
If someone offered to respray my car for £600 etc etc, i wouldnt even consider it.

If a jobs worth doing, its worth doing right.

But for talkings sake... i would class the lotus colour as standard, its probably a 2 or 3 stage pearl, which means it need s coloured basecoat applied before the proper colour (pearl applied). The base colour is basically part of the equation which makes up the final colour.
We dont really say standard colour. Its either a colour change or not. Thats about as technical as it gets, in this case it would be a colour change and the pearl paint probably wouldnt be much more than a standard colour the only difference would be that there would be an extra colour required if the paint was a 2 or 3 stage pearl like i say.
